Specifications of ERJ3BWFR039V

Resistance
0.039ohm
Resistance Tolerance
± 1%
Power Rating
250mW
Resistor Element Material
Thick Film
Resistor Case Style
0603
No. Of Pins
2
Temperature Coefficient
± 150ppm/°C
Lead Free Status / RoHS Status
Lead free / RoHS Compliant
